Free Attendance App for Employees – Step-by-Step Setup Guide

If you are searching for a free app to track your employees' attendance, check-in, and check-out time, then you are on the right path of the internet.

In this guide, we'll show you how to create your own free attendance app using simple Google tools — no coding, no paid software, just a few easy manual steps.

Let's get started!

Free Attendance App for Employees – Step-by-Step Setup Guide

Why You Should Try a Free Attendance App Setup

For startups, small offices, or field teams, attendance tracking is essential — but not everyone is ready to invest in HR or sales tracking software right away.

With a few free Google apps (Forms, Sheets, and Drive), you can build a manual but functional attendance app to record check-in and check-out times, and generate basic reports.

Step-by-Step: Build Your Own Free Attendance App

Step 1: Create a Google Form for Check-In & Check-Out

1. Go to Google Forms

Go to Google Forms

2. Click "Blank Form"

Click Blank Form

3. Add the title: Employee Attendance – Check-In & Check-Out Form

Add the title Employee Attendance – Check-In & Check-Out Form

4. Create these fields:

Employee Name (Short answer)

Create these fields – employee name

Employee ID (Optional)

Create these fields – Employee ID

Select Action (Dropdown: Check-In / Check-Out)

Create these fields - Select Action Dropdown: Check-In / Check-Out

Final Look:

Create these fields- final look

5. In the settings (⚙️), turn on "Collect email addresses" if you want to track who filled the form.

Turn on Collect email addresses from settings

Step 2: Connect Google Form to Google Sheets

1. Open your Form → go to the "Responses" tab. Click on the green Sheets icon.

Open your Form. Go to the Responses tab. Click on the green Sheets icon

2. This automatically creates a linked Google Sheet that logs every form submission.

Creates a linked Google Sheet

3. Every submission will automatically record: Timestamp, Employee Name, Employee ID, Action (Check-In / Check-Out).

Every submission will automatically record

Step 3: Use Formulas to Track Attendance Time

You'll notice each response already includes a timestamp (submission time).

To make your report easier to read:

1. Keep the "Timestamp" column as-is. Add two new columns: Check-In Time and Check-Out Time

Add two new columns Check-In Time and Check-Out Time

2. Use the following formulas:

  • =IF(D2="Check-In", A2, "")
  • =IF(D2="Check-Out", A2, "")
Use the formulas

This automatically separates check-in and check-out times into their own columns.

Free vs Automated: Attendance System Comparison

Feature Free Google-Based Setup 1Channel Automated Attendance
GPS Tracking ❌ Not available — employees can check in from anywhere ✅ Real-time GPS-based check-in & check-out
Photo / Location Verification ❌ No verification available ✅ Photo, GPS, and location proof
Automation Level ❌ Manual data entry and cleanup ✅ Fully automated attendance with alerts
Reporting ❌ No automated reports ✅ Auto-generated daily, weekly & monthly reports
Team Scalability ❌ Suitable only for small teams ✅ Scales easily for growing field teams
Integration ❌ No integration with CRM / SFA ✅ Seamlessly integrated with CRM & SFA modules
Ease of Use ⚠️ Needs manual steps and basic technical skills ✅ Super easy mobile-first interface

Know About 1Channel

Discover how 1Channel's AI-powered automation can transform your field team attendance tracking with GPS, photo verification, and real-time reports.

Explore 1Channel AI →

Free Download: Employee Attendance Sheet (Excel Template)

To make this process even easier, download our ready-to-use Excel Attendance Sheet, designed for daily manual entry or cross-verifying Google Sheet data.

Download Free Employee Attendance Sheet (Excel)

This file helps you manage attendance records offline and can be customized with your company's branding before you switch to a full automation system.

Final Thoughts

Building your own free attendance app using Google tools is an excellent first step for learning and managing small teams.

But when you're ready to scale or need accuracy, automation is the key.

Try this manual setup first, and then explore how 1Channel can transform your attendance tracking experience — from manual to intelligent.

Insights

Want to get more insights? Click on a category below for more
Free Demo
Book Free DemoChat Expert